The share price of ARP seems to be dictated mostly upon last published bid price. The big price spike in this stock occurred when it was determined Barrick had approached the Lundins with $5.50/share. Even though it was rejected, people logically thought it must be worth around $5.50.

I do find it interesting that volume has been sizable over the last couple of days...given the lull in bid activity I would expect very quiet volume but that has not been the case.
